MENU

解决deepin扫描不到WiFi和蓝牙信号问题


【阿里云】爆款云产品,新客特惠全年最低价,云服务器低至0.4折起,11.1开售
【腾讯云】爆款1核2G云服务器首年48元,还有iPad Pro、Bose耳机、京东卡等你来抽!
【华为云】上云特惠巨划算,免单抽奖享豪礼
【七牛云】爆款云产品全年最低价,热门产品 0 元秒杀,参与抽奖赢新款 iPhone

今天为我的联想拯救者Y7000笔记本安装了Windows10+deepin15.10.1双系统,但是启动deepin后发现无线网络无法扫描的WiFi信号,经过一番搜索后,找到了解决方案。
理论上联想系列电脑安装Linux遇到此问题大部分可以解决。(Manjaro其他方法)

1.问题原因

首先打开终端,输入

rfkill list all

得到如下结果

0:ideapad_ wlan: Wireless LAN
Soft blocked: no
Hard blocked:yes
1:ideapad_ bluetooth: Bluetooth
Soft blocked: no
Hard blocked: yes
2: phy0: Wireless LAN
Soft blocked: no
Hard blocked:no
3: hci0: Bluetooth
Soft blocked: yes
Hard blocked: no

因为优先级靠前的ideapad_wlan的Hard blocked默认为yes,即deepin默认关闭了硬件开关,而联想拯救者Y7000的WiFi只有软件开关,没有硬件开关的启动,所以导致了WiFi无法扫描到信号的问题。

但是序号为2的WiFi模块是软硬件可以启动的,所以将前面默认的模块移除即可。

2.解决方法

  1. 移除ideapad无线模块

    sudo modprobe -r ideapad_laptop
  2. 再次使用命令查看

    rfkill list all

得到如下结果:

2: phy0: Wireless LAN
Soft blocked: no
Hard blocked:no
3: hci0: Bluetooth
Soft blocked: yes
Hard blocked: no

可以发现已经能够使用无线网扫描到WiFi信号了。

  1. 由于每次重启都要重新将模块移除,所以可以编写脚本,将命令设置为开机自启动

    vim /etc/rc.local

输入以下内容,其中password为用户密码

#!/bin/sh -e
#
# rc.local
# This script is executed at the end of each multiuser runlevel.
# Make sure that the script will "exit 0" on success or any other
# value on error.
#
# In order to enable or disable this script just change the execution
# bits.
#
# By default this script does nothing.
echo "password" | sudo modprobe -r ideapad_laptap
exit 0

为文件增加执行权限

chmod +x /etc/rc.local
  1. 至此成功解决deepin无线网扫描不到WiFi信号的问题

3.解决蓝牙扫描不到设备问题

  1. 使用命令查看蓝牙状态

    rfkill list all

得到如下结果:

2: phy0: Wireless LAN
Soft blocked: no
Hard blocked:no
3: hci0: Bluetooth
Soft blocked: yes
Hard blocked: no

可以看到第3项Bluetooth中的Soft出于block状态,所以需要在软件层面实现蓝牙的开关。

  1. 安装bluetooth

    sudo apt install bluetooth
  2. 将Soft blocked设为no

    sudo rfkill unblock bluetooth
  3. 再次查看蓝牙状态

    rfkill list all

得到如下结果:

2: phy0: Wireless LAN
Soft blocked: no
Hard blocked:no
3: hci0: Bluetooth
Soft blocked: no
Hard blocked: no

这时候可以发现蓝牙已经可以搜索到了蓝牙设备。


版权属于:LeeYD · Blog
本文标题:解决deepin扫描不到WiFi和蓝牙信号问题
本文链接:https://www.leeyiding.com/archives/30/
版权声明:本博客所有文章除特别声明外,均采用 BY-NC-SA 4.0 许可协议
若转载本文,请标明出处并告知本人

【阿里云】爆款云产品,新客特惠全年最低价,云服务器低至0.4折起,11.1开售
【腾讯云】爆款1核2G云服务器首年48元,还有iPad Pro、Bose耳机、京东卡等你来抽!
【华为云】上云特惠巨划算,免单抽奖享豪礼
【七牛云】爆款云产品全年最低价,热门产品 0 元秒杀,参与抽奖赢新款 iPhone

最后编辑于: 2020 年 01 月 19 日
返回文章列表 文章二维码 打赏
本页链接的二维码
打赏二维码
添加新评论

打卡

评论列表
  1. repostone repostone     Windows 8.1 /   Google Chrome

    能自己解决问题还不错。